Reworking the Lemania 2310 is a risk. Getting it wrong is easy. This doesn’t.

The FXR-4 is not a tribute. It is a rebuild. Created by Jean-Marc Fleury, the watch takes the architecture of one of the most respected chronograph movements ever made and re-engineers it for modern performance.

At its core is the in-house calibre FM04. While it retains the defining elements of the original, column wheel and horizontal clutch, it has been fundamentally upgraded. Power reserve is extended to 60 hours, frequency set at 21,600 vph, and the entire movement scaled up to 32.5mm to improve both stability and visual presence.

This is where most reinterpretations fall short. They either preserve the past too closely or lose it entirely. Here, the balance is correct. The mechanical identity remains intact, but the weaknesses are removed.

The movement is fully visible through the sapphire caseback, and this is where the value sits. German silver bridges treated with NAC give a contemporary tone, while traditional finishing techniques, straight graining, mirror polishing, and hand-finished edges, reinforce its haute horlogerie positioning.

The dial is deliberately restrained. A deep blue base with horizontal satin brushing provides texture without distraction. Sub-dials are cleanly laid out, with circular finishing and minimal numerals, only the date register carries them. Red lacquer chronograph hands add contrast without overwhelming the design.

The 40mm case is executed in recycled stainless steel, aligning with Fleury’s sustainability approach without compromising on execution. A subtle but important detail is the date corrector at 7 o’clock, integrated cleanly into the case.

Limited to just 11 pieces per dial variant, this is a watch aimed squarely at collectors who understand the significance of the Lemania lineage but want something technically relevant today.

This is not nostalgia. It is progression.
